| Marwah -Warwan cut off as -old Marwah Bridge collapses | | | Early Times Report Jammu, May 15 : The only surface link between snow clad Marwah and Warwan area of mountainous district of Kishtwar -the old wooden bridge constructed over river Marrusudar collapsed leaving over 40000 souls cut off from rest of the state. As per the details, the only wooden bridge connecting remote Marwah valley through surface link collapsed due to recent incessant rain and snowfall witnessed in the area. "Sensing urgency, the government today Deputed Chief Engineer R&B Abdul Hamid Sheikh & Executive Engineer R&B Division Marwah Abdul Rashid Bhat (Rxecutive Engr R&B) and others rushed to remote area by a chopper to assess the damages to the bridge and its due repairs, reports said. Reports said after taking stock of the damages, the Chief Engineer R&B will submit its report to government so that the work on this historic bridge could be undertaken. It is pertinent to mention that Marwah and Warwan area of Kishtwar District having nearly 50000 population remains cut off from other parts of the state during 6 months in winters beside the area also sans of electricity and other means of communication. It is only the summer months when the remote area get connected with rest of state through a only road connectivity to Warwan area. Although the government has sanctioned a project to enhance the road connectivity to the area some over two decades ago but the work on the road is moving at snail pace reasons better known to concerned authorities. |
